Retract your Steps

The process of tracing your steps can help you find your keys. This sounds like the oldest piece of advice, but it can be extremely useful in locating lost car keys replacement cost items. The first step is to return to the last place you remember having your keys. If you dropped your keys while getting out of your car, look around your garage and driveway. Look under all the things that might have fallen on the table, if you dropped them.

If retracing your steps does not work, try writing down everything that you did during the day to stir up memories of where your keys could be. This may also narrow your search.

Contact a locksmith

There are many possible reasons why you could lose your car keys. The best way to avoid this from happening is by keeping a spare Key lost on hand, or using one of the many Bluetooth key trackers on the market. This will help you find your car in just a few minutes, and save you money on a locksmith and a tow back at the dealer.

If you do end up losing your car keys, then it is important to report the incident as soon as you can. This will ensure that your keys aren't stolen or used by someone else. It will also help ensure that your insurance company is able to provide you with the right insurance coverage should you need to make a claim.

If you lose the keys to your car, you must first check all the usual places where they are stored. Contact a professional locksmith to get the replacement. They will usually do this on-site, and they will make use of the most recent technology to create a duplicate key and program it for you.

It is also crucial to be aware that you must only work with an experienced locksmith in making these kinds of replacement keys. They should have the appropriate tools to remove stuck or bent keys without further damaging them. They should be able to offer you a guarantee for their work.

Some dealerships are able to create new keys for customers, but this can cost more than working with an outside locksmith. It is also essential to determine whether your insurance policy will cover the cost of a locksmith or a new key from the dealership.
